Job Description

Humedica is looking for a motivated Senior Statistical Analyst who is passionate about creating statistical analyses that will provide insight into the quality, safety and efficiency of the health care system.  Humedica develops analytic systems for physicians and hospitals that extract and present data and analytics to help improve the safety and quality of health care. Analysis, algorithms, statistical models, and compelling statistical graphical approaches created by the Senior Statistical Analyst will be embedded within the analytic systems, providing a major source of insight for our clients.

Experience & Skills
Humedica is looking for an experienced statistical analyst with extensive experience in using SQL for complex analysis and experience in, or an interest in learning, R.
 

  • 5+ years direct experience working with SQL
  • Extensive experience with data manipulation techniques in SQL
  • Extensive experience in using SQL for developing algorithms
  • Experience analyzing large complex multi-table data sets
  • Ability to think analytically and develop approaches to generate needed metrics through the joining of tables and development of complex algorithms
  • Working knowledge of R preferred, interest in learning R is required
  • Familiarity with the medical domain is a definite plus, a passionate interest in working with health care data is a must


Qualifications

  • Education: BS/MS in Mathematics/Statistics/Biostatistics or an MPH with a strong emphasis on statistical and/or analytic methods, or equivalent education.
